It could be your connection or the sites output bandwidth.
Some connections especially with ISPs like talktalk orange and a couple of others are slow to get up to speed, after connecting to the internet, do you ever get a warning saying no or limited connectivity? Bearing in mind if you are also connecting with torrent programs, downloading or opening instant messengers, this will all eat into your bandwidth.
If there are a lot of people also logging on or refreshing the same page as you are trying to access the site server may not be able to cope with the demand to pass the information out quickly, this is often indicated by the browser taking a while to update then showing the 'cannot be accessed' message.
How long does the cant open site condition last for? does it go if you leave it for a minute or so then refresh the page?
